Text

Licensees shall have one year from the effective date of this section to implement sections 4512 (relating to risk assessment), 4513 (relating to information security program), 4514 (relating to corporate oversight) and 4516 (relating to certification) and two years from the effective date of this section to implement section 4515 (relating to oversight of third-party service provider arrangements).
